Fallen Angel (1989) is a quirky blend of comedy, drama, and fantasy that really captures an offbeat vibe. The film, directed by an unknown hand, has this almost dreamlike pacing, weaving between the humorous and the melancholic in a way that feels very unique. The atmosphere is both whimsical and a bit surreal, with practical effects that add an interesting texture to the narrative. The performances are sincere, capturing that raw human emotion, even in the more absurd moments. What stands out is its thematic exploration of longing and the search for meaning, wrapped in a package that doesn’t take itself too seriously. It’s definitely one of those hidden gems that cultivates a certain charm.
